YUFE Student Forum

How can YUFE stay young, student-centred, and non-elitist? The YUFE Student Forum has a lot to do with this!

The purpose of the YUFE Student Forum is to ensure that the perspective of the students is always present in the implementation of the YUFE vision. Each partner university elects three students who represent their institution in the YUFE Student Forum and the work packages, which are responsible for the implementation of YUFE.

The President of the YUFE Student Forum even co-chairs the YUFE Strategy Board, the highest decision-making body in the YUFE Alliance. The YUFE governance structure thus reflects the extent to which the YUFE Student Forum representatives are important players in co-leading and co-creating the YUFE project and vision.

Meet the Co-Creators of YUFE

The student members within YUFE have been acting as co-creators rather than student representatives.

This has played and will continue to play an essential role in the success of the project.

Given the involvement of the students as co-creators, we expect the YUFE Student Forum to be more than a mere advisory or representative body; instead, we envision the YUFE Student Forum to continue to fill the role of an equal partner during the YUFE pilot phase.

In this context, it is essential that the YUFE Student Forum’s activity is fully integrated in the processes and activities of the Alliance at all levels, including the work packages.
